Detailed Game Introduction

Jungle Bricks is a captivating and modern take on the classic brick-breaker genre. Set in a vibrant jungle, the game challenges players to clear an ever-advancing wall of numbered bricks. Unlike traditional brick-breakers where you control a paddle, here you aim and shoot a volley of balls from a fixed point. Each brick has a durability number that you must reduce to zero to destroy it. The goal is to survive for as long as possible by strategically clearing the bricks before they reach the bottom of the screen.

Gameplay Strategy & Walkthrough

  1. Aim for Angles: The key to a high score is maximizing the number of hits per shot. Avoid shooting straight up. Instead, aim for the sides of the screen or gaps between bricks to create complex ricochets. A well-aimed shot can have your balls bouncing around the screen for a long time, clearing multiple bricks at once.
  2. Prioritize High-Threat Bricks: Always focus on the bricks that are closest to the bottom of the screen. A single brick touching the bottom line will end your game, so clearing these should be your top priority.
  3. Look for Power-ups: Some bricks may contain power-ups, such as extra balls. Targeting these can dramatically increase your clearing power for subsequent turns.
  4. Plan for the Descent: After every shot, all bricks on the screen will move one step down. Keep this in mind when planning your shots. A safe-looking board can become dangerous in just a few turns if you don’t clear bricks efficiently.

Controls Guide

The game uses simple, one-touch controls.

  • Aim: Click and hold the left mouse button (or your finger on a touch screen) and drag to aim. A guideline will appear showing the initial trajectory of your shot.
  • Shoot: Release the mouse button (or your finger) to fire the balls.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  • Q: What do the numbers on the bricks mean?

    • A: The number represents the brick’s “health” or the number of times it must be hit by a ball before it is destroyed.
  • Q: How do you lose the game?

    • A: The game ends if any brick successfully reaches the bottom line of the play area.
  • Q: How can I get more balls?

    • A: Look for special blocks with a ”+” or similar icon on them. Hitting and destroying these blocks will often add more balls to your volley for the next shot.
